|
|
|
в какой нф диаграмма
|
|||
|---|---|---|---|
|
#18+
Здравствуйте, у меня такой вопрос, соответствует ли данная модель хоть каким то требованиям к рбд, мне кажется, что в ней много ключей. Я в этом вопросе нубоват. К самой модели предъявлено только такое смысловое требование: Абитуриенты из различных потоков поступают в различные группы различных специальностей, различных факультетов вуза. Буду рад, если вы мне подскажете алгоритм, как выявлять и тестировать аномалии. Заранее спасибо :) 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 16.11.2012, 08:33 |
|
||
|
в какой нф диаграмма
|
|||
|---|---|---|---|
|
#18+
stenio, У абитуриента, вроде, уникальный ID_абитуриента. Ну может паспортные данные. В остальном могут быть повторы: в частности, на одном потоке, в одной группе, тем более по одной специальности и на одном факультете - полно народу, вроди. Потому не понятно, что означают ключики напротив них. И воообще не понятно - это один составной там ключь или действительно туча ключей. Но в любом случае последние 4 не выглядят как ключевые ни по одиночке ни даже в совокупности. Ить даже если это один составной ключ и 5 колонок, то это не ключ, а суперключ, поскоку содержит ключ ID_абитуриента (т.е. лишние они там). 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 16.11.2012, 09:19 |
|
||
|
в какой нф диаграмма
|
|||
|---|---|---|---|
|
#18+
stenio, Более того, там, из этих 4, возможно, тока группа в этой табле должна остаться.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 16.11.2012, 09:24 |
|
||
|
в какой нф диаграмма
|
|||
|---|---|---|---|
|
#18+
Пардон и номер потока 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 16.11.2012, 09:25 |
|
||
|
в какой нф диаграмма
|
|||
|---|---|---|---|
|
#18+
Оба оставшихся - внешние ключи. По аналогии и в остальных лишнее выкидывать, скорее всего, моно и оставшиеся делать внешними ключами. Ну, без дополнительной инфы, кажется чт как-то так.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 16.11.2012, 09:28 |
|
||
|
в какой нф диаграмма
|
|||
|---|---|---|---|
|
#18+
vadiminfo, у каждой сущности уникальный ключ, который стоит на первом месте, остальное-плоды связей один-ко-многим (причем во всей диаграмме только такие связи). То есть остальные, помеченные как ключи - это внешние ключи. В сущности абитуриент еще потенциальным ключем (если я правильно выражаюсь) может являться данные аттестата.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 16.11.2012, 10:00 |
|
||
|
в какой нф диаграмма
|
|||
|---|---|---|---|
|
#18+
steniovadiminfo, у каждой сущности уникальный ключ, который стоит на первом месте, остальное-плоды связей один-ко-многим (причем во всей диаграмме только такие связи). То есть остальные, помеченные как ключи - это внешние ключи. В сущности абитуриент еще потенциальным ключем (если я правильно выражаюсь) может являться данные аттестата. Ну тада эти значки ключа - сбивают с толку. Однако, скорей всего, код_специальности и номер_факультета - лишние в таблице Абитуриент. Номер факультета - лишний в таблице Группа. Ить их можно вычислить из других таблов, по всей видимости. Например, зная группу абитуриента, его специальность и факультет, можно соуденив с группой и специальностью.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 16.11.2012, 10:21 |
|
||
|
в какой нф диаграмма
|
|||
|---|---|---|---|
|
#18+
мм. согласен, получается ключ от родителя уйдет в обычные атрибуты дочерней сущности?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 16.11.2012, 12:33 |
|
||
|
в какой нф диаграмма
|
|||
|---|---|---|---|
|
#18+
stenio, Может я не точно понял что Вы имели в виду, но, возможно, то что Вы хотите сказать, связано с понятием миграции ключей.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 16.11.2012, 12:59 |
|
||
|
в какой нф диаграмма
|
|||
|---|---|---|---|
|
#18+
stenioЗдравствуйте, у меня такой вопрос, соответствует ли данная модель хоть каким то требованиям к рбд, Честно говоря, постановка выглядит настолько бредовой, что состав и структуру сущностей комментировать просто бессмысленно. Она не из этого мира (ну или по крайней мере из совершенно не знакомой мне его части :) Что же до требований к рбд - судя по всему, у Вас используются идентифицирующие связи с миграцией внешнего ключа, как минимум по пути факультет - специальность - группа - абитуриент, что неверно.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 16.11.2012, 13:40 |
|
||
|
в какой нф диаграмма
|
|||
|---|---|---|---|
|
#18+
vadiminfo, спасибо, немного прояснилась моя мутная голова 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 16.11.2012, 13:51 |
|
||
|
в какой нф диаграмма
|
|||
|---|---|---|---|
|
#18+
stenioДа о нем Ну типа да. CASE тулсы это типа поддерживают: рисуете связь, они сами всатвляют внешние ключи. ERWIN, на скока помню так делал.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 16.11.2012, 13:55 |
|
||
|
|

start [/forum/topic.php?fid=32&msg=38040868&tid=1541469]: |
0ms |
get settings: |
9ms |
get forum list: |
18ms |
check forum access: |
4ms |
check topic access: |
4ms |
track hit: |
90ms |
get topic data: |
11ms |
get forum data: |
2ms |
get page messages: |
48ms |
get tp. blocked users: |
1ms |
| others: | 239ms |
| total: | 426ms |

| 0 / 0 |
